Denmark Clarifies VAT Rules for Gospel Choir Singing Lessons by Self-Employed Directors

  • The Danish Tax Agency clarified the VAT treatment of gospel choir singing lessons.
  • A self-employed choir director provided paid lessons to two gospel choirs organized as associations.
  • The director asked if these services could be VAT-free.
  • The Tax Council ruled that the lessons are not exempt from VAT.
  • The choir director is considered a taxable person for providing these services.
